Fast Foods for Fat Loss, with Eat by Color

What you need:

Steak

Sweet Potatoes

Asparagus

Garlic, salt, minced, fresh, make it easy

Butter

Olive Oil

Balsamic Vinegar

Put your steak in a dish, pour some balsamic vinegar on, dust with whatever garlic you have, slice thin pieces of butter put on stop.  Set to the side.

Cook sweet potato.  Microwave if you must or bake in the oven or on the grill.  Slice thin.  Put olive oil in frying pan add sliced potatoes, cover and put over low heat.  Turn, flip, mix often.

Wash the asparagus.  Trim the end.  Put in foil.  Drizzle some olive oil over.  You can go crazy and add some balsamic vinegar or your favorite seasoning.

The steak and asparagus go on the grill.

Fast Food for Fat Loss

What you need

 

Rotisserie Chicken

Peppers

Onion

Garlic, fresh, minced, salt you pick make it easy

Olive Oil

Flatout Foldit, new discovery, high in fiber (none of us eat enough fiber, “Eat by Color” google it topic from the book)

Shred the chicken.  I have found your hands work best.  Yes, you are going to have to get dirty with this one.

Dice  your vegetables

Add Olive Oil to Skillet and turn on the heat, I also dumped the juice from the chick in as well.

Add your chicken and vegetables

Cook until vegetables are soft.   Serve as is OR you can make some cool, high fiber flat bread sandwiches using some of these.
